## Changelog — Lanternfish 2.8.0: Hot-reload defaults changed

Hot-reloading of configuration is now enabled by default, with a 15-second debounce instead of immediate application. If you're onboarding, note that edits to the config file no longer require a restart, but malformed files are rejected and the previous snapshot is kept. The new shipped defaults are listed below.

config for kafof-bawef:
holath:
  log_level: debug
  metrics_host: metrics.holath.qorvelsys.internal
  pin: 2191
  pool_size: 32

## Authentication

As of the v7 payroll export format change, PaystreamSync no longer accepts the legacy CSV uploads, and every export request to the internal Ledgerworks endpoint must now carry a service credential in the request header. If you are on call and the nightly export fails with a 401, do not regenerate credentials yourself — that invalidates the scheduled jobs for the whole Fernvale payroll team. Instead, verify the header is present and correctly formed, then retry once using the current key below.

gateway credential: zpat15_lMLOSdhT94y0U3l

**Mgmt Meeting Minutes — Retiring the Brightline Range**

Quick recap for sales leads at Fenholt Supplies: we agreed to retire the Brightline fixture range by year-end. Remaining stock moves to clearance pricing next month, and accounts on standing orders get migrated to the Lumetta range. Trade-in incentives were approved in principle. The confidential note on next steps sits just below.

board note of bajof-bajeg: The pricing group signed off on a budget of $13.4 million for Project Sildor. The renewal with Lamixek Holdings closes at $48.9 million a year, 49 percent above the last contract.

Handing off the Quillbus broker upgrade (4.x to 5.1) to Dario. Cluster is half-migrated; mixed-version mode is supported but TLS cert rotation must finish before cutover. No auth model changes, though the admin API gained two new endpoints worth reviewing. Open questions and the migration checklist are tracked on the internal page below.

dashboard of taduf-bawef = https://jira.lumicsys.internal/projects/display/browse/b1cbf89d